
Health influencer Stacey Warnecke sadly passed away following 'extremely rare' complications from giving birth, which took place in her home.
Stacey was a Melbourne-based nutritonist who often made videos about healthy food and living on her many social media pages.
The husband of 30-year-old influencer Stacey, also known as Stacey Hatfield, confirmed the tragic news that she died last month.
Nathan Hatfield explained that his wife had died while giving birth to their first child at home, and issued a lengthy and heartfelt statement as he informed her followers.

While sharing a picture from their wedding day, Nathan went into detail about what complications occurred that resulted in Stacey's death.
He wrote: “Its with heavy heart that i share with you the unexpected passing of my beautiful wife, soul mate and best friend, Stacey Warnecke (Hatfield).

“Stace passed on the 29th September 2025 after successfully giving birth to our firstborn son, Axel, at home. Tragically, shortly after, an unforeseen and extremely rare complication arose and she passed after being transferred to hospital.

"Hospital staff were amazing and did the utmost to help, but ultimately nothing could be done despite their best efforts.
"I knew Stace for 9 amazing years, she was the light of my life and the reason I got up in the morning. Words can't do justice to how devastating this is for myself and everyone that knew and loved her. She was my lighthouse in the storm and the world is less bright without her in it.
"As her husband, i couldn't ask for a better partner. She was the most beautiful, loving, caring, hardworking, disciplined, intelligent and trustworthy human being I've ever known. She made me the man I am today and everything i have in life is all thanks to her.
"The happiest day of my life was getting to marry her, my best friend, on a white sand beach in the Maldives."

Many of the page's thousands of followers also issued sweet and heartfelt messages in response to the news.
Nathan concluded his tribute by thanking everyone who had reached out and left messages and he concluded that 'If there's one thing that I can try and reconcile in this horrible time is that her last moments on earth were the happiest i've ever seen her'.
The husband did not go into more detail as to the nature of the complication that arose that caused Stacey’s death, however.

He also set up a GoFundMe page to help support himself and Axel going forward.
So far, over $33,000 AUD ($21,453) has been raised of the $50,000 goal.
